Our client is seeking a WAREHOUSE OPERATIVE to join their team on a permanent basis. This is a physical manual labourer role working within a food production environment. The main purpose of this role is to de-boxing 20kg blocks of cheese and lifting them onto a conveyor. You may also carry out other warehouse duties like lifting and shifting stock and using IT / scanning systems for stock allocation as and when required. At times you may also be required to operate forklift trucks hence FLT licence is desirable, but not essential. This is a working farm located in the village of Litton Cheney, Dorchester hence needing own transport to get to site.
